Photograph, House of Hector Guimard

This is a Photograph. It was architect: Hector Guimard. It is dated ca. 1910 and we acquired it in 1956. Its medium is gelatin-silver print. It is a part of the Drawings, Prints, and Graphic Design department.

This object was donated by Madame Hector Guimard. It is credited Gift of Madame Hector Guimard.

Its dimensions are

Mat: 35.6 × 45.7 cm (14 × 18 in.) 20 × 26 cm (7 7/8 × 10 1/4 in.)

It has the following markings

Stamps in purple ink, verso: J.E. BULLOZ / EDITEUR - PARIS
